Owners manual....

"Use only anti-freeze additive G12++, an additive meeting the
specification “TL 774 G”. Other additives may give considerably
inferior corrosion protection. The resulting corrosion in the cooling
system can lead to a loss of coolant, causing serious damage to the engine"

Dexcool does NOT meet VW's TL-774 standard.

My suggestion is to stay with what is recommended by the manufacturer.

You'll be in for a big ($$$$$) surprise when you start mixing and matching coolants in these cars.

VW or Audi dealers sometimes sell small topping-off bottles. You can also purchase the stuff (G12++) from NAPA under the Pentosin name plate.

^^ True! But it's suggested to use distilled water. Chemicals added to tap water could cause harm to engine parts/hoses.

G13 is the new standard with Audi vehicles it can be mixed with regular G12 G12+ and G12++
